Understanding the Role of a Manhattan General Contractor

Definition and Importance

A Manhattan General Contractor serves as a critical liaison between the project’s clients and the various skilled trades involved in any construction endeavor. This role encompasses a range of responsibilities, ensuring that construction projects are completed on time, within budget, and according to the specified standards. The importance of hiring a competent contractor cannot be overstated, as they not only facilitate the execution of the project but also help mitigate risks associated with the construction process.

Key Functions and Responsibilities

The functions of a Manhattan General Contractor are diverse and integral to the success of construction projects. They include:

  • Project Planning: Detailed analysis of project specifications and timeline establishment.
  • Budget Management: Creating accurate cost estimations and overseeing expenditures.
  • Team Coordination: Managing subcontractors and ensuring that everyone is on the same page regarding the project goals.
  • Permitting: Acquiring necessary permits and ensuring compliance with local regulations.
  • Quality Assurance: Overseeing work quality to meet industry and safety standards.

Licensing and Insurance Requirements

In New York City, all general contractors must be licensed and carry insurance. Verification of these credentials is essential for protecting yourself against potential liabilities. A licensed contractor not only complies with legal requirements but also indicates professionalism and reliability.

Best Practices for Collaboration with Your Contractor

Establishing Clear Communication

From the outset, establishing clear lines of communication is imperative. Decide on preferred communication channels, whether it’s regular meetings, phone calls, or emails, and stick to them. This consistency fosters a productive working relationship.

Regular Progress Meetings

Scheduling regular progress meetings can provide opportunities to assess the project status, discuss any ongoing challenges, and re-evaluate timelines as necessary. It’s an effective way to ensure all parties are aligned and aware of their responsibilities.

Managing Changes and Adjustments

Construction projects are dynamic, often requiring adjustments. Employ a systematic approach for handling changes, which includes clear documentation and agreements on any alterations. This practice smooths the transition and helps in avoiding potential disputes later on.
